Modbus Method

Communications Procedure
The inverter communicates with an external controller as follows.
(1) Query
External
controller
Inverter
(1) Frame (Query) that is sent from the external control device to the inverter
(2) After receiving a query frame, the inverter waits for the total time of the Silent Interval and the
Communication Wait Time (C078), before returning a response.
Silent Interval
The wait time that is specified on Modbus communication; its data length is 3.5 characters
(3.5 bytes).
It depends on the Modbus communication speed setting.
(3) Frame (Response) that is sent from the inverter back to the external controller
(4) After sending a response, the inverter monitors the time until it completes receiving the query frame
from the external control device. The inverter judges it as a communications error if it receives no
response within the Communication Error Timeout Time (C077).
Then, the inverter operates according the Operation Selection on Communication Error (C076),
while waiting for the reception of the first data again.
The monitoring of the Communication Error Timeout Time starts from the first sending/receiving
operation is established after the power supply is cycled or after the inverter is reset.
The inverter does not recognize as a communications error timeout if the sending/receiving
operation is not established at all.
